The park was opened and dedicated in 1993, to the victims of the St. Valentine's Day fire at the Stardust Nightclub in the Artane area of Dublin. During this tragic fire, 48 people were killed and an additional 214 people were injured. The park was designed and funded by a combination of agencies and organizations, including the Stardust Victims Committee, local government and Dublin City Council.
Although it is a sad memory for many people, the beauty of the park is a true tribute. The central area of the 20-acre park features a life sized bronze statue of a dancing couple. Surrounding the statue is a beautiful pool, with 48 jets that provide a continuous fountain. There is also a pond complete with swans, children's playground area and well maintained walking paths through beautiful landscaped grounds.
